Episode Description

I have the pleasure to be joined this week by Rev Dr. Julie Moret. She has recently released her book "What's Your What? How to Ignite your unique brand." We talk openly about her journey during this process, what prompted her to write her book. Talk about fear, what to do when it shows up in our lives, as well as other real life challenges and what brings her the greatest joy. We discuss why its is so important for her to inspire people to find their purpose. In her TEDx LA talk May 28, 2015 and "What's Your What?" she talks a lot about moving forward "come what may" why this theme is so strong for her and offers practical tools to the listeners. We also talk about the power of the mind, learning to guide it and becoming more in partnership with it as well guided imagery. During the program she gives a sample of this and invite us to join her. She is also a speaker at Agape International Center and tells us about the center.

The Sky’s the Limit

Archives Available on VoiceAmerica Empowerment Channel

The Sky’s the Limit is a motivating, inspirational program which is based on my journey from medical professional to patient, highlighting people from all walks of life and various stages of overcoming adversity, their challenges and awakening to the rediscovery of themselves, a transformation. I engage with a number of successful life coaches, authors, athletes and everyday people who discuss their journey and process as well as exploring the concepts of Eastern and Western medicine. We are all learning life’s lessons every day and living in the moment, no matter where we are in our journey.

Karen Leavitt

Karen Leavitt is a restorative coach. With her background as an accomplished career nurse, and a survivor of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I), Karen has a unique perspective on how to navigate life-changing events. Utilizing her skills in health and wellness, public speaking, advocacy and teambuilding, she guides others to achieve healthy, balanced, successful lives, regardless of their circumstances.

Karen is happy to be returning to VoiceAmerica after a life changing event resulted in a traumatic brain injury post-concussion syndrome. Now, Karen has a dynamic purpose and passion that is igniting her to guide others. A former successful career nurse, advocate, “natural care giver,” and athlete, Karen brings positivity and resilience grounded in reality through her own journey and experiences.
